What is Martin Short’s net worth in 2024?
Martin Short reportedly has an estimated net worth of around $30 million in 2024.
In 2024, Short’s net worth is derived from multiple income streams. These encompass his appearances on television and film, live gigs, and voice acting. He has amassed his wealth through comedy tours, stand-up shows, as well as acting in TV series and movies. Furthermore, he supplements his earnings with voice-over jobs for animated films and royalties from previous projects.
prominently recognized for his humorous characters on television shows such as Saturday Night Live and SCTV, Short is also well-known for his appearances in movies like Three Amigos! and Father of the Bride. More recently, this actor has garnered widespread acclaim for his portrayal of Oliver Putnam in the successful TV series Only Murders in the Building. In this show, he shares screen time with Steve Martin and Selena Gomez.
What does Martin Short do for a living?
Martin Short is predominantly recognized for his work as an actor and humorist, yet he possesses skills in writing and production too. Over the years, he’s established a flourishing career by tackling a wide array of roles across television, cinema, and live performances.
Short’s “Only Murders in the Building” has garnered widespread praise from critics and boasts a large fanbase. This series focuses on three individuals, initially unknown to each other, who team up to launch a podcast aimed at solving a murder within their Manhattan apartment complex.
Martin Short’s earnings explained — how does he make money?
Martin Short derives income from numerous career avenues such as acting in TV shows and movies, stand-up comedy performances, providing voiceovers, and even production. Moreover, he enjoys residuals from his previously successful projects that still resonate with viewers today.
